I'm just interested in the different views and if things are changing with the cross over between differing combat sports or how differnt is it in Muay Thai as compared to Kickboxing, Boxing or MMA. How much is just the "culture" of that particular sport and therefore acceptable. And especially thoughts from thoes who are there to uphold the rules, ie Refs. Do you tolerate quite a high level of encouragements and instruction from corners or are you firm on them. In some codes a fighter can be disqualifed from a bout because of their corners behaviour so there is an intent in the rules that it is an important issue but sometimes looks to be ignored. The general crowd and fightes team mates/family etc are different and is all part of the excitement and vibrantcy of the sport and if it gets out of hand then it is up to security to deal with. But Refs do have control over the fighter and corner team so is there a common understanding as to how much it too much? For example is denigrating the opposing fighter where you draw the line? I see one of the prime responsabilities of the corner team is to keep calm, controled and focused, rather than getting caught up in and carried along with the emotion and excitement that is a combat sport bout. Yet sometimes see some of the loudest coaching and encouraging from corners as being emotion driven rather than (in my view) good coaching.
